Fosfomycin: Uses and potentialities in veterinary medicine
D S Pérez1, M O Tapia1, A L Soraci1
1Laboratorio de Toxicología, Centro de Investigación Veterinaria de Tandil, Departamento de Fisiopatología, Facultad de Ciencias Veterinarias, Universidad Nacional del Centro de la Provincia de Buenos Aires, Tandil, Buenos Aires, Argentina ; Consejo Nacional de Investigaciones Científicas y Técnicas (CONICET), Buenos Aires, Argentina.
Fosfomycin (FOS) is a broad-spectrum antibiotic effective against Gram-positive and Gram-negative bacteria. Its unique properties and low toxicity make it a promising option for treating bacterial infections in both humans and animals.

Background:
- Fosfomycin (FOS) is a natural bactericidal antibiotic with broad-spectrum activity.
- It inhibits bacterial cell wall synthesis and exhibits synergistic effects with other antibiotics.
- FOS possesses unique properties including biofilm penetration, immunomodulatory effects, and protection against drug-induced nephrotoxicity.
Purpose of the Study:
- To provide animal health practitioners with comprehensive information on Fosfomycin (FOS).
- To highlight the potential of FOS as a promising antimicrobial agent in veterinary medicine.
- To discuss the drug's properties, efficacy, and applications in both human and animal health.
Main Methods:
- Review of existing literature on Fosfomycin (FOS) properties and applications.
- Analysis of pharmacokinetic profiles and bioavailability across different species and salt forms.
- Examination of FOS efficacy in treating various bacterial infections in humans and animals.
Main Results:
- FOS demonstrates bactericidal activity against Gram-positive and Gram-negative bacteria.
- The antibiotic exhibits good diffusion into body fluids and tissues due to low molecular weight and high water solubility.
- FOS has shown efficacy in treating infections like E. coli and Salmonella spp. in broilers and various bacterial infections in piglets.
Conclusions:
- Fosfomycin (FOS) is a versatile antibiotic with low toxicity and broad-spectrum efficacy.
- Its unique pharmacokinetic properties and demonstrated efficacy in human medicine suggest significant potential for veterinary applications.
- Further recognition and utilization of FOS in veterinary medicine are warranted for treating diverse bacterial infections.
